Did a search and found only 1 thread on the subject.
I took the 69 out for it's 3rd test run. When I got her back in the garage, I did a walk around looking for drips, leaks or other problems. I felt the rear diff cover and noticed it felt rather hot. I could touch it, but not for more than 10-15 seconds. I took my remote temp gun and it measured 143 degrees.
Is this normal, or should I open the cover and look into it further?
The left rear brake drum was a little warm also. The right side was cold.
